Induction hobs use electromagnets to heat your pans, making them more energy efficient than other types. They also have the added bonus of only heating the pans when you're using them, which means they shut off automatically when your cooking is done. You'll still need to make sure you choose the correct pans for the hob. Steel and cast iron are the best single oven, but aluminium and copper pans with magnetic bases also work with an induction hob.

You can select between gas and electric models when shopping for a single oven that has a hob. Electric cookers will have an electric hob that can be made of ceramic, induction or solid sealed plates. They also include fans to ensure that the heat generated by the oven is distributed evenly. This can mean that an electric cooker can take longer to reach the ideal temperature than a gas one however, it offers more precise control of the heating process. It also includes a range of features like a built-in timer and self-cleaning functions.
On the other hand, a gas cooker will provide instant heat and precise control over the heat of your food using a choice of burners to meet your cooking needs. When a single oven with a stove is being used for the first time, it's important to conduct tests before cooking anything. This involves preheating an empty oven at high temperature for around an hour to burn off any odours or residues from manufacturing. Then, gradually increase the temperature and cook a variety of recipes to familiarize yourself with your new model.
